Re: satellite technology. There's a couple confounding factors that limit the image quality and resolution of earth observation satellite (EOS) images. 1. Launch vehicle cowling diameters - 2.5m. That restricts the size of the mirror used to collect the images. Yes, the James Webb telescope gets around this by using multiple mirrors, but there are no EOS satellites using that tech. NASA was gifted an unused "spy" EOS by NRO years back. It had a 2.5m mirror. Long story short, 4"/px resolution is the max until someone develops a wider rocket. Picture 4" squares on a person's face....about 6 pixels - far too few to identify an individual - and that's assuming they are lying flat on the ground. The "read a license plate from space" thing is not true. 2. Atmospheric conditions. Water vapor/clouds obscure observation, and typical atmospheric mixing distorts imaging. What you need to worry about is drones that can loiter for long periods, while continuously sending imagery to the watchers AI, as well as the Stingray cell skimmers. Those are death for privacy - along with NSA gathering all your electronic traffic.

@@ZaneConnor I think you mean hyperspectral. That's generally captured by aerial platforms, although USGS has a hyperspectral satellite. Resolution is coarse...like 100 meters/px. One thing to know is that on EOS platforms only the greyscale band is the quoted/highest resolution. The other bands in a multispectral sensor are half as detailed (red, green, blue, infrared, etc). The RGB images you see are created by digital marriage of the grey band with the colored bands, which also introduces errors/artifacts. Due to collection issues, image quality issues, and price satellite imagery is rarely used by non-federal actors anymore, except for large, landscape scale collections - think Alaska.
